WebNov 17, 2024 · In return, they get the property tax lien, which gives them the ability to foreclose on you and take the title in 12 months in Georgia. You have a 12 month period to save up the money and pay the lienholder the money to redeem the property. This money includes: The back tax amount. The 20% annual interest. Late fees.
